Lucinda Brand has now reached 50 consecutive podium finishes on the CX bike. By my calculations, the pro women's record belongs to Marianne Vos (obvs), at just 51, only two more podiums and Brand tops the GOAT.

(Van der Poel? 66. Brand could do it outright this season...)

A curious detail of the UCI's yellow card could turn it into a sort of get-out-of-jail-free card for Van Poppel.

If he gets a 2nd at the Deutschland Tour today, he'll get a 7-day suspension, but it'll also wipe both cards issued here from his tally, returning him to a relatively safe (ahem) three.
